They say pregnancy brings a glow. They say you get beautiful skin and thicker, more luxurious hair...

Yeah, I'd like to know who "they" are.

And where exactly are "they" getting their information?

Me? I've got no glow. Instead, I have acne. And hair so greasy that 10 hours after washing you'd think I'd bathed in an oil slick.

Oh yes, and an eczema-like patch of red flakies under my nose that drifts down over my upper lip. And no matter how much Neosporin/Hydrocortisone/Polysporin I rub on it - it ain't goin' away.

Talk about fun in buckets and spades. When you've just thinned out 2/3 of your wardrobe - staring at your almost-thirty-year-old yet eerily teenage-acne-face in the mirror just doesn't do much for the whole self-esteem and body image.

So I decided to go get my nails done today. I mean, a nice plain French manicure - at least when I go to church tomorrow I can look at my hands and think, "Thank goodness there's one part of me that doesn't look like something the cat dragged in!"
